"Gluttony" had two forms: novel and television series. The novel "The Story of Gluttony" told the story of the love story between the heroine Zhu Chengbi, who had amazing culinary skills, and the handsome young master Chang Qing, who was a transvestite. The work depicted the tradition of demon beasts eating humans from a unique perspective. It explored topics such as wealth and splendor, longevity, changing fate against the heavens, and stabilizing the country. It showed the two sides of the world's sweetest and fattest taste, as well as the bitterness and sourness of the human heart. The TV series "Gluttony" described the famous Heavenly Fragrance Restaurant in Daliang's No Summer City, which attracted many nobles and generals. The loli shopkeeper Zhu Chengbi (played by An Yuexi), who had superb culinary skills and beautiful looks, could make new tricks with any ingredients, and the accountant Chang Qing (played by Wang Youshuo) had a wonderful pen. The two of them experienced many thrilling events together. Chang Qing watched Zhu Chengbi cook one dish after another. Each dish contained a story. They were involved in the joys and sorrows of the human world, love, brotherhood, husband and wife, mother-son relationship, and the crisis of the country. The two people who were in love with each other were about to have different fates. In order to save his life, King Langya set up a trap for Zhu Chengbi and Chang Qing to seriously injure each other, forcing Zhu Chengbi to make longevity dishes for him to extend his life. He also wanted to release the Black Kylin, forcing Zhu Chengbi to transform into a Taotie and lose his mind to swallow Chang Qing.
